Job Summaries:

Major Gifts Officer:

  • These professionals are at the forefront of identifying, cultivating, and soliciting significant donations from high-net-worth individuals.
  • Their role includes crafting personalized engagement strategies, organizing donor appreciation events, and nurturing long-term donor relationships.
  • A bachelor’s degree in a relevant field, along with experience in fundraising or relationship management, is typically required.
  • Success hinges on strong communication and organizational skills.

Director of Major Gifts:

  • The Director oversees the major gifts program, developing strategies for donor engagement and stewardship.
  • This role demands extensive fundraising experience, project management skills, and team leadership abilities.
  • Candidates often hold a master’s degree in nonprofit management or a related field.
  • They play a critical role in shaping fundraising strategies and maximizing donor contributions.

Donor Relations Manager:

  • Focused on enhancing relationships with existing donors
  • Creates communication plans
  • Manages recognition programs
  • A bachelor’s degree in communications or nonprofit management is usually required
  • Excellent writing and interpersonal skills are vital for donor retention
